Molly McGrath is going back to the Motherland.
The California native and former Boston College cheerleader began her career at ESPN before leaving for Fox Sports, but she is headed back to ESPN, as announced on Wednesday.
“It is great to welcome Molly back to ESPN,” said senior coordinating producer Lee Fitting. “Versatility is one of her many strengths that will be on display throughout the college football and basketball seasons. She immediately makes our college sports coverage better and we look forward to working with her for years to come.”
